Royal Air Maroc Adds Flights to Repatriate Moroccans from Ukraine
Royal Air Maroc continues to increase its flights to repatriate Moroccans stranded in Ukraine. The national airline has scheduled two new flights on Saturday, March 5.
On its Twitter account, RAM announced two new flights for Moroccans from Ukraine, scheduled for this Saturday, March 5, departing from Bratislava and Warsaw to Casablanca, at the same fixed price of 750 MAD all inclusive.
Since the Ukrainian airspace has been closed since the launch of the Russian offensive last week, the government has called on Moroccans to leave the country through border crossing points with Slovakia, Poland, Hungary and Romania.
RAM had already announced 3 flights on March 3 and 4, 2022 departing from Bratislava, Bucharest and Budapest to Casablanca.
